Other neighbourhoods around Miragaia

Vitória
While you're in Vitória, take in top sights like Livraria Lello or Clerigos Tower, and hop on the metro to see more of the city at Guilherme Gomes Fernandes Stop or Carmo Stop.

São Nicolau
Visitors to São Nicolau love its stunning river views, and you can check out Stock Exchange Palace and Ribeira Square. If you want to see more in the area, you can get around town on the metro at Infante Stop.

Ribeira
The ample dining options and beautiful river views are top of the list for many visitors to Ribeira. A stop by Ribeira Square or Porto Historic Center might round out your trip.
